Gill Shakespeare Focus: King Lear is a new and beautifully illustrated version of the play which expertly assists students in understanding Shakespeare’s great work and thoroughly prepares them for the Leaving Certificate examination.
Focused scene-by-scene analysis:
• Introductory Overview
• Summary and in-depth Critical Analysis
• Key Quotes plus commentary
• Exam-style questions and Sample Paragraphs with Examiner’s Comments.
Essential study notes:
• Characters and relationships – analytical study
• Central Themes and Issues
• Dramatic Techniques – including imagery, letters, plot and sub-plot, irony and soliloquies
• Succinct treatment of King Lear as a Comparative Text – modes defined, key moments explored
• Exam Focus – purposeful use of key scenes, paragraphing succinctly, quoting effectively
• Full Sample Essays – marked and graded with invaluable Examiner’s Comments
• Sample answer plans and paragraphs enable students to scaffold successful answers
• Sample Leaving Certificate exam questions relevant to the latest changes in the exam.
The Authors
Martin Kieran and Frances Rocks are experienced teachers and examiners who have written several Leaving Certificate English textbooks. Martin has worked for many years as Chief Advising Examiner for Leaving Certificate Higher Level English. Frances delivers in-service workshops for second-level teachers of English throughout the country.
